小程序 拖拽 小程序 拖拽按钮

小编 2023-12-29 89

小程序拖拽及小程序拖拽按钮的实现方法和应用场景

小程序拖拽及小程序拖拽按钮是指在小程序开发中,实现用户可以通过拖拽操作来移动、调整或交互的功能。拖拽操作在用户体验中起到了重要的作用,能够提升交互的灵活性和直观性。在小程序中,拖拽操作常常用于实现图标、按钮、卡片等可移动的元素,以及实现拖拽排序、拖拽调整大小等功能。

小程序拖拽按钮的实现方法

小程序  拖拽 小程序 拖拽按钮

实现小程序拖拽按钮的方法有多种,下面介绍其中两种常用的方法:

1. 使用wx.getSystemInfoSync()方法获取屏幕宽高信息,然后通过touchstart、touchmove、touchend等触摸事件来实现拖拽功能。具体步骤如下:

- 获取屏幕宽高信息:使用wx.getSystemInfoSync()方法获取屏幕宽高信息,并保存在变量中。

- 绑定触摸事件:在按钮组件上绑定touchstart、touchmove、touchend等触摸事件,用于处理拖拽过程中的操作。

- 实现拖拽功能:在touchstart事件中记录起始坐标,在touchmove事件中计算位移距离,并更新按钮的位置。在touchend事件中完成拖拽操作。

2. 使用小程序官方提供的拖拽组件:小程序官方提供了一些常用的拖拽组件,如movable-area和movable-view。使用这些组件可以简化拖拽按钮的实现过程。具体步骤如下:

- 在页面中引入movable-area和movable-view组件,并设置相应的属性,如movable-area的宽高,movable-view的初始位置等。

- 在movable-view组件中放置需要拖拽的按钮元素,并设置相应的样式和属性。

- 通过监听movable-view的touchstart、touchmove、touchend等触摸事件,实现按钮的拖拽功能。

小程序拖拽按钮的应用场景

小程序拖拽按钮可以应用于多种场景,以下列举几个常见的应用场景:

1. 图片管理小程序:在图片管理小程序中,用户可以通过拖拽按钮来调整图片的顺序或位置。用户可以通过拖拽按钮将图片进行排序,或者将图片拖拽到特定的位置进行分组管理。

2. 购物车小程序:在购物车小程序中,用户可以通过拖拽按钮来调整购物车中商品的顺序或数量。用户可以通过拖拽按钮将商品进行排序,或者通过拖拽按钮来增加或减少商品的数量。

3. 页面布局小程序:在页面布局小程序中,用户可以通过拖拽按钮来调整页面中各个元素的位置和大小。用户可以通过拖拽按钮来改变页面中元素的排列顺序,或者通过拖拽按钮来调整元素的大小。

以上是小程序拖拽及小程序拖拽按钮的实现方法和应用场景的详细描述。通过实现拖拽按钮,可以提升小程序的用户体验,增加交互的灵活性和直观性。

The End
微信